Bhubaneswar, India :
The Odisha State Pollution Control Board (OSPCB) has conducted a Public Hearing at Koira on Thursday (26th Sep) in connection with enhancement of production capacity from 1.5 MTPA to 4 MTPA at the Koira Iron Ore Mines and setting up of a 1.2 MnTPA Pellet Plant at Nuagaon by Essel Mining and Industries Limited (EMIL), an Aditya Birla Group Company has been concluded peacefully and successfully.
The public hearing, where more than 1000 villagers have participated has been accomplished under the Chairmanship of Shri Rabindra Nath Mishra, ADM, Rourkela in the presence of Shri Niranjan Mallick, Regional Officer, State Pollution Control Board (RKL), Shri Ramakant Nayak, Sub-collector, Bonai, Shri Basudev Naik, Tahasildar, Koira, Shri Vimsen Choudhry, the Local MLA, Shri Janardan Dehuri, former MLA, the respective Sarapanchas, ward members, block members etc.
Appreciating the local area developmental work being carried out by EMIL, the public in general have proposed to give employment preference to the local youths befitting to their qualification and skills during the meeting.
